Interest on up to $750,000 of mortgage debt can … camera kruidvatWebWith an interest-only mortgage, you only pay the interest on the loan. At the end of the term, you’ll still owe the original amount you borrowed. The main advantage of paying a mortgage on an interest-only basis is that your monthly payments will be much cheaper.
